In what's become a running theme this season, the Veritas Collegiate Academy Spartans gave their fans yet another huge win on Thursday. They took their game on the road with ease, bagging a 95-47 victory over Veritas School. The victory was nothing new for Veritas Collegiate Academy as they're now sitting on seven straight.
Veritas Collegiate Academy got their victory on the backs of several key players, but it was Marcqell Freeman out in front who scored 20 points along with seven rebounds and five assists. Freeman has been hot recently, having posted 18 or more points the last ten times he's played. Another player making a difference was Jailen Pinnix, who scored 15 points along with five assists and five rebounds.
Veritas Collegiate Academy is on a roll lately: they've won 13 of their last 14 matchups, which provided a nice bump to their 17-3 record this season. As for Veritas School, their loss was their fifth straight at home, which dropped their record down to 4-13.
